Choosing the Right Platform: Free Website Builders
When embarking on your journey to create a free website, selecting the right platform is a critical decision. Several free website builders are available,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Let's explore some popular options. Google Sites is a user-friendly platform, perfect for beginners. Its seamless integration with other Google services, like Drive and Docs, makes it easy to add content and collaborate. Wix is another excellent choice, offering a wide range of templates and customization options. Its drag-and-drop interface is intuitive, allowing you to create a visually appealing website without coding knowledge. Weebly is known for its simplicity and ease of use, making it a great option for those who want to get their website up and running quickly. It also offers e-commerce features, allowing you to sell products online. When choosing a platform, consider your specific needs and goals. If you need a simple website for personal use, Google Sites might be the best option. If you want more design flexibility, Wix could be a better fit. And if you plan to sell products online, Weebly's e-commerce features could be a deciding factor. SEO Basics for Your Free Website: YouTube Guidance
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is crucial for driving traffic to your free website, and YouTube is packed with tutorials to guide you through the basics. Start by understanding keyword research. YouTube videos can teach you how to identify the terms your target audience is searching for. Tools like Google Keyword Planner can help you find relevant keywords with decent search volume and low competition. Once you have your keywords, learn how to incorporate them naturally into your website's content, page titles, and meta descriptions. Many YouTube tutorials focus on optimizing these elements for search engines. Pay attention to the length and relevance of your meta descriptions, as they can significantly impact your click-through rates. Building backlinks is another essential aspect of SEO. YouTube videos can show you how to acquire high-quality backlinks from reputable websites. This can involve guest blogging, directory submissions, and other link-building strategies. Make sure your website is mobile-friendly, as Google prioritizes mobile-first indexing. YouTube tutorials can guide you through optimizing your website for mobile devices, ensuring it looks and functions well on smartphones and tablets. Don't forget about website speed. YouTube videos can provide tips on how to improve your website's loading time, which is a crucial ranking factor. This can involve optimizing images, minimizing HTTP requests, and using a content delivery network (CDN). Regularly monitor your website's performance using t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console. YouTube tutorials can teach you how to interpret the data and identify areas for improvement. Monetizing Your Free Website: Exploring Options on YouTube
So, you've created your free website and now you're wondering how to make some money from it? YouTube is an awesome resource for learning about monetization strategies. One of the most common methods is through advertising. YouTube tutorials can show you how to set up Google AdSense on your website and display ads. You'll learn about different ad formats, placement strategies, and how to optimize your ad revenue. Affiliate marketing is another popular option. YouTube videos can teach you how to find affiliate programs related to your website's niche and promote products or services. You'll learn how to create compelling content that encourages visitors to click on your affiliate links and make a purchase. Selling digital products is a great way to monetize your website if you have valuable content to offer. YouTube tutorials can guide you through creating and selling e-books, online courses, templates, and other digital products. You'll learn about different platforms for selling digital products and how to market them effectively. Offering membership subscriptions is another option to explore. YouTube videos can show you how to create a membership program on your website, where users pay a recurring fee to access exclusive content or features. This can be a great way to generate a steady stream of income. Donations can be a viable option if you're providing valuable content or services for free. YouTube tutorials can teach you how to set up a donation button on your website and encourage visitors to support your work. Remember to comply with all applicable laws and regulations when monetizing your website. YouTube videos can provide guidance on topics like GDPR compliance, FTC disclosures, and other legal considerations.
